两千人被裁,NASA航天梦,遭遇前所未有冲击
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-07-11 06:40
Core Viewpoint - NASA's announcement of cutting over 2,000 senior employees reflects significant budget cuts and project cancellations, indicating a potential decline in the U.S. space exploration sector and its global technological leadership [1][3][4]. Policy Impact - The large-scale layoffs and budget reductions are primarily driven by pressures from the Trump administration, which aims to streamline government operations and control fiscal spending, but this strategy may undermine the U.S.'s global technological dominance [3][4]. - The cancellation of numerous scientific projects, including significant initiatives like the James Webb Telescope and Mars sample collection, poses a direct threat to scientific progress and may lead to a loss of top talent in the U.S. scientific community [3][4][6]. International Competition - As the U.S. reduces its space investment, other nations, particularly China, the EU, and India, are increasing their space exploration efforts, which could lead to a shift in global space competition dynamics [4][8]. - The potential decline in U.S. space capabilities may result in a loss of international influence and technological leadership, as other countries advance their space programs [4][8]. Domestic Impact - The layoffs will have a profound effect on the U.S. job market and the technological ecosystem, as senior scientists, managers, and engineers are critical to innovation and organizational stability [6][8]. - The morale within NASA may suffer due to the layoffs, leading to further talent attrition and a decline in the competitive edge of the U.S. space sector [6][8]. Long-term Considerations - Space exploration is not merely a government expenditure but a vital driver of technological innovation, impacting various sectors such as satellite communications and weather forecasting [8][9]. - The militarization of space and competition for resources necessitate a robust U.S. presence in space; reducing investment could jeopardize national security and strategic advantages [8][9]. - The current layoffs signal a need for the U.S. to reassess its space strategy, balancing short-term fiscal pressures with long-term technological capabilities to maintain its leadership position [8][9].
火箭总设计师是个高二男孩
Bei Jing Wan Bao· 2025-06-01 07:56
Core Points - The "Feiyan No.1" meteorological sounding rocket, developed by middle school students from Shenzhen, Beijing, Hebei, and Shandong, successfully launched and reached an altitude of 10,555.7 meters, collecting meteorological data [1][3][5] - The rocket measures 1.52 meters in length, can fly over 8 kilometers, and has a maximum speed of approximately 2 Mach (about 2,450.16 km/h) [3][5] - The project began on June 26, 2024, with students engaging in design, experimentation, and assembly processes [3][5][6] Development and Education - Wang Yuning, a high school student, served as the chief designer of "Feiyan No.1" and emphasized the importance of innovation and practical learning in aerospace [3][4][5] - The project was supported by various institutions, including the Chinese Academy of Sciences and several aerospace companies, providing technical guidance [5][8] - The school has established three aerospace technology laboratories and a curriculum to foster creativity and practical skills among students [7][8] Team Collaboration - The rocket club at Yanchuan Middle School has grown to 50 members, with weekly lectures on rocket design and engineering [5][7] - Team members collaborated on various aspects of the rocket's design and functionality, showcasing a strong team spirit and innovative thinking [6][7][8] - The successful launch of "Feiyan No.1" reflects the effectiveness of the school's aerospace education system and the students' dedication to their projects [7][8]
